- The distance between Sibu, Malaysia and Corpus Christi, Tx, Usa is approximately 15,427 km or 9,586 mi.
- To reach Sibu in this distance one would set out from Corpus Christi, Tx bearing 312.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sibu bearing 221.1° or SW .
- Sibu has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Corpus Christi,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Sibu is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ome whereas Corpus Christi, Tx is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 4.3 °C (7.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.8 °C (26.6°F) less in Sibu.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2455 mm (96.7 in) more which is equivalent to 2455 l/m² (60.25 US gal/ft²) or 24,550,000 l/ha (2,624,558 US gal/ac) more. About 4 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.5° higher in Sibu than in Corpus Christi, Tx.
